Soontagana campsite’s observation tower (1.5 km from the parking)
The observation tower is located 1.5 km from the parking lot of the Soontagana campsite. From the tower, which is on the bog island of Avaste Nature Reserve, you can have the view to the Soontagana hill fort and the beautiful heritage landscape. This place has been a refuge for people from conquerors for several centuries. Only a very secret path through the bog led to the hill fort. The road was under water and only people who knew could find their way to the fortress. In the 13th century, there have been several forays to Soontagana - Swedes, Germans with Livonians and Pskov Russians. Now meadows, old farms and stone fences surround the fortress. The history of two of the farms in known back 22 generations.
Parking
Parking for 10 cars in the parking area of the campsite; the campsite is not accessible by car.
Amenities
16 m high wooden observation tower, covered on top
Outdoor Fireplace
Covered Fireplace
Sights
Rich historical and cultural heritage: fortress, old farmsteads, stone fences, cellars

Drive on Mihkli–Kõima–Vahenurme road until the sign shows left to Soontagana hill fort. Follow the signs to the hill fort. Leave your car at the parking area and walk 1.5 km to Soontagana campsite.
